-----BEGIN PGP SIGNED MESSAGE----- Hash: MD5 Hi Serg, SB> Is there a way to somehow enumerate a directory structure on a remote SB> webserver? Brute force springs to mind but thats mathematically SB> impossible, to go through all combinations, etc. You can try DIRB (originally directory bruteforcer) http://www.t0s.org/dirb.php It works by launching a dictionary attack against a web directory an analizing the responses. - -- Saludos, Ramon mailto:rpinuaga@s21sec.com -----BEGIN PGP SIGNATURE----- Version: 2.6 iQEVAwUAQTG/CpCN2MkDASy5AQGE1Qf+M6pBy6djUg52l56d4t5EHXXMX2viSOoj yMfqiJMYQdYteRFmudhZ9XB0YhzSSU5VpgbmlbXK5eT7eOzhs7k1o59IB9gb/f3N hkXLcqPpsMlfCsWAJCXGeayoXbnQxLPgYTG6ndMZ/QGRLOJffQEWCoCXA/2aj+Bf uXK4ZsSwG6vzgDxEXH2JbKWwVgOd2HWbIjKbM6XcppNKXmIss4aVidy7WSTGUssQ aXnZO9reYWKNball0UVPRSdMajOpOAk+MwLcNrfY+Y4QKNn40MN+DYfuCMVrDurG nkSNl/iHGTVzV6oXoj3U1PJE89qd582PHBW//NJ3AIEiAxo8iC1ghw== =b8OK -----END PGP SIGNATURE-----
